Research Abstract |
Arteriosclerotic vasculopathy in the kidney on 0-hour biopsy sample is a risk factor for lower allograft function. Pre-treatment with ARB on hypertensive donor with microalbuminuria reduced microalbuminuria but could not induce remission of hypertensive nephrosclerosis in the pathological findings. In living-donor kidney transplantation, early intervention by ARBs from pre-operative period in living-donors who exhibit normal-high microalbuminuria is needed to prevent ischemic reperfusion damages.
